The hypo(below) thalamus is an almond size structure located superiorly to the brainstem. it is located below the thalamus. Hence the name hypothalamus.

It is primary function is is to control the body homeostatic functions of sleeping and waking up, sex, thirst and hunger etc.

It performs these roles by serving as the primary link of the nervous system with the endocrine system. Pituitary gland is an example of  endocrine gland that secrets many hormones. (they are called endocrine because the hormones are secreted directly into the blood streams.

Its activities are controlled by the nervous stimulation from hypothalamus. Therefore the instructions to secretes certain hormones to the post and anterior part of the pituitary gland depends on the hypothalamus.

Growth hormones, oestrogen, and thyroid are examples of hormones of the pituitary glands.

What ecological factors do you think might come into play when deciding how to time a pulse flow?

Answers

Answer:

- Species inhabiting the river and surrounding areas

- Hydraulic characteristics

- Geomorphology dynamic

- Water quality

Explanation:

Presence of different species: Assay the species inhabiting the area of the river corridor. These species include invertebrates, animals such as fishes, amphibians, reptiles, birds, and mammals, and plants living near the shore and on the floodplain. These species might be affected in some portion of their life cycles by the difference in the river pulse flows. Life stages and population dynamics might be considered of importance when timing the pulse flow.

Hydraulic characteristics: Habitat in aquatic systems varies according to the season and the pulse flow. Depth, velocity, substrate, and instream cover might be considered important factors influencing the presence of different species and their development.

Geomorphology: Refers to the shape of the channel and floodplain. These will depend on the stream velocity, sedimentation, depth, among others. The river geomorphology is in constant change, from season to season. This dynamic also affects the shape of the floodplain and riparian zone.

Water quality: Refers to the difference in sediments, suspended elements, available nutrients, dissolved oxygen, and temperature. All of these affect and influence different forms of life and their evolution through the corresponding cycle stages.

During MEIOSIS, an event called crossing over occurs. Explain what happens during this event.​

Answers

Answer:

During meiosis, an event known as chromosomal crossing over sometimes occurs as a part of recombination. In this process, a region of one chromosome is exchanged for a region of another chromosome, thereby producing unique chromosomal combinations that further divide into haploid daughter cells.

what three phases of the cell cycle are considered interphase

Answers

Answer:

The cell cycle has three phases that must occur before mitosis, or cell division, happens. These three phases are collectively known as interphase. They are G1, S, and G2. The G stands for gap and the S stands for synthesis.

Explanation:

The three phases of the cell cycle that are considered interphase include G1, S phase and G2.

The cell cycle can be divided into the interphase and mitotic (M) phases.

The interphase can in turn be divided into a Growth G1 phase, synthesis (S) phase and Growth G2 phase.

The synthesis of the genetic material (DNA) occurs in the S phase, whereas in G1 and G2 the cell synthesizes all materials required to enter into cell division.

In conclusion, the three phases of the cell cycle that are considered interphase include G1, S phase and G2.

why do we spread talcum powder on a carrom board while playing

Answers

We sprinkle powder on carrom board to make the surface of the board smooth. This reduces the friction between the surface of the carrom board, the striker and the coins. As a result, the coins and the striker can move easily on the carrom board.

The DNA sequence TTT codes for the amino acid lysine. The DNA sequence TTC

also codes for lysine. What can you conclude from this information?

Answers

Answer:

The genetic code is degenerate and therefore mutations may go unnoticed.

Explanation:

Each triplet of nucleotide bases, which is known as a codon, encodes for a specific amino acid during translation. However, a single amino acid may be coded by different codons. It is for that reason that the genetic code is considered to be degenerate. In this case, Lysine amino acid can be encoded by both TTT (UUU in the mRNA) and TTC (UUC) codons, thereby a mutation T>C at the third nucleotide codon position does not affect the resulting protein (i.e., it is a silent mutation).
